I just did a fresh install of fedora core 6 and upgraded to the latest 
version of 2.6.18-1.2849.fc6.  I am using the wilsonet guide to installing 
mythtv and when I get to the part to install the ivtv drivers I am getting 
an error.  The drivers install properly with 

yum -y install ivtv-kmdl-$KVER 
and have even tried
yum install ivtv ivtv-kmdl-`uname -r`

When I do a  rpm -qa | grep ivtv I get
ivtv-0.8.0-121.fc6.at
ivtv-firmware-1.8a-10.at
perl-Video-ivtv-0.13-8.fc6.at
ivtv-kmdl-2.6.18-1.2849.fc6-0.8.0-121.fc6.at

When I run the command uname -r I get
2.6.18-1.2849.fc6

Now I try to load the modual with the command modeprobe ivtv and get the 
following error
modprobe ivtv
FATAL: Error inserting ivtv 
(/lib/modules/2.6.18-1.2849.fc6/updates/drivers/media/video/ivtv.ko): 
Invalid module format

I have used this method many times and things worked fine.  Is there 
anything special with this kernal that I need to know about.  When I 
looked at the lists I could not find a similar problem.
